Stars - the number of stars that a project has on GitHub. Growth - month over month growth in stars.
Activity is a relative number indicating how actively a project is being developed. Recent commits have higher weight than older ones.
For example, an activity of 9.0 indicates that a project is amongst the top 10% of the most actively developed projects that we are tracking.

Gleam 0.15 – Type-safe language for the Erlang VM
We have a fully type safe and Erlang compatible OTP library! It is used in production today.
https://github.com/gleam-lang/otp
It is not a wrapper around gen_server etc, but instead it is a full implementation from the ground up using a very small core. This was done because:
a) Erlang OTP cannot be typed, we need different abstractions are designed with types in mind
b) We want to be confident that our abstractions are powerful enough to build something like OTP, rather than cheating by relying on type casts.
I'm very happy with how Gleam OTP is going, but it is not the focus now that an initial version is out. Tooling and documentation is more important at the moment.
